A lot of readers are writers, too. Whether you’re a bestselling author or an aspiring wordsmith, if you have a short mystery in the works, the Margery Allingham Short Story Competition wants to see it!

You don’t need to be published, and you don’t have to be a CWA member. All you need is an original, unpublished story of 3,500 words or less that fit Margery Allingham’s description of a mystery:

“The Mystery remains box-shaped, at once a prison and a refuge. Its four walls are, roughly, a Crime, a Mystery, an Enquiry and a Conclusion with an Element of Satisfaction in it.”

In addition to the honour of the win, the author of the winning entry will receive a cash prize of £500.

The deadline for entry is 29 February 2024. More details here.
